US Public Transit Ridership in 2008 At Highest Level in 52 years; 10.7B Trips

Green Car Congress

The light rail system that started in November 2007 in Charlotte, NC showed the highest percentage of increase with an annual 862% increase. Major increases by large bus agencies occurred in the following cities: Phoenix (11.5%); San Antonio (10.2%); San Diego (10.0%); St. Louis (8.9%); Baltimore (8.7%); and Denver (8.6%).
